Damaged Opener Rail
Garage door opener rail is visibly bent or twisted, causing jerky movement.

Possible Causes
Impact from vehicle, Operating opener with locked door, Excessive door weight, Improper installation support
How to Fix / Troubleshooting
Safety first: Disconnect power and secure the door in the closed position before working on the rail.
Steps to address:
- Assess damage: If the rail is slightly bent, minor straightening may be possible. Severe bends or kinks require rail replacement.
- Attempt gentle straightening: With the rail removed from the header and opener, carefully straighten using padded clamps or a vise. Avoid creating new kinks.
- Replace rail if needed: Order a Motorlift replacement rail assembly compatible with your model and install per manufacturer instructions.
- Check door hardware: Correct any underlying door issues (binding, weight) that may have caused the rail to bend.
